8 days in Serbia! This was actually my first travel experience outside of EU and it was so amazing, i want to see more of Balkans! We primarily stayed in Belgrade and took two day trips to Golubac, Smederevo, Kapetan Misin, Djerdap national park, Resavska cave, Veliki buk, Krupajsko vrelo and Manasija Monastery. I live in Latvia which is very flat, so seeing the breathtaking mountain views was something off my bucket list. All i can say that it was the best travel experience i have ever had, previously Barcelona was my top 1, but this trip was everything. No stress, no worries, AMAZING and helpful people, a lot of places were tourist spots for local tourists so there was some language barrier but people everywhere were so helpful and kind! Belgrade was chill aswell, except for crazy traffic i’ve not seen before (driving style and beeping).
